How Can You Accurately Estimate the Cost of Replacing a Roof in Frisco?

Is your home in Frisco starting to show signs of wear from storms, sun, or age? If you’re considering a replacement, understanding the potential cost is the first step toward making a smart decision. Many homeowners get overwhelmed by unexpected fees or misleading quotes. But estimating the cost doesn’t have to be a guessing game, especially when you’re familiar with the process and local standards. Here’s how to break down the price before making that big investment.

Start with a Reliable Local Quote

In Frisco roofing company can provide a more precise estimate than generic online calculators. That’s because local conditions, such as frequent hail or heatwaves, or city permit requirements, can impact the total cost. A contractor will assess your home’s structure, materials, and size more accurately. They’re familiar with regional pricing trends and can provide a breakdown based on real numbers, not rough estimates. Always start with at least two quotes from companies that have a solid track record in the Frisco area.

Measure the Surface Area Carefully

The size of your home plays a big role in estimating the cost. Larger homes naturally require more materials and labor. While you can find tools online to help calculate square footage, it’s still better to let a professional take exact measurements. Many older homes in Frisco have unique angles, additions, or slopes that complicate the renovation process. A small miscalculation here can lead to hundreds or thousands of extra dollars. Precision in measurement ensures a more accurate financial plan.

Factor in Material Choices

The type of material you choose matters more than you think. Shingles, tiles, and metal all come with different price points. In Frisco, roofing company opt for impact-resistant materials that can withstand unpredictable weather. But those options come with higher upfront costs. Understanding how different choices affect your estimate can help you strike a balance between budget and durability. Always ask the contractor to list the pros, cons, and prices of each option clearly in your quote.

Include Labor, Cleanup, and Permits

Beyond the physical materials, there are hidden parts of the job that influence cost. Labor fees vary across Frisco depending on demand, skill level, and timeline. Cleanup, especially removal of old material, is another important factor that often gets overlooked. You’ll also need to account for city permits. In Frisco, a fully licensed roofing company will handle these, but the fees are passed on to you. Ensure that everything is listed line by line in your estimate to avoid any unpleasant surprises.

Watch for Extras and Unforeseen Costs

Even the best plans can face setbacks. Your structure may have hidden damage, or the project may take longer than expected. In Frisco’s unpredictable climate, sudden weather delays are also not unusual. Reputable contractors will warn you of possible add-ons in advance. This might include repairing water damage or updating insulation. Build a little flexibility into your budget just in case. It’s better to be prepared than to be caught off guard halfway through the project.

Replacing the top of your home is a major investment, and getting the cost right from the start is essential. In a growing city like Frisco, understanding local factors and collaborating with professionals who are familiar with the area ensures that your estimate is both fair and realistic. From measurements to materials, labor, and permits, every detail counts. So take your time, ask questions, and always read the fine print. A smart estimate today means fewer headaches tomorrow and lasting protection for your home.
